Reggae Riddims: A International Spread

Dancehall productions, originating from the vibrant sound systems of Jamaica, have undergone a remarkable transformation, progressing from a local phenomenon to a truly global phenomenon in music. Initially, these instrumental tracks – defined by their unique basslines, syncopated percussion, and often, a feel of raw energy – provided the template for dancehall vocalists to vocalize over. What began as a essential element of dancehall culture, enabling DJs to showcase their lyrical prowess, soon began to be repurposed by artists across the globe. From groundbreaking remixes in electronic music to its substantial influence on pop and hip-hop, the essence of these Jamaican instrumentals continues to inspire new musical expressions, cementing dancehall's enduring presence on the world’s music scene. The trend shows no signs of slowing.

Reggae Music: A Caribbean Heritage

Dancehall sound, emerging from Jamaica in the late 1980s, stands as a powerful testament to the island's artistic innovation. Initially a development of reggae, it rapidly developed into a distinct style, characterized by vocal performances over driving beats and a energetic lyrical approach. What began as street parties and reggae clashes quickly earned widespread recognition, reaching far beyond Jamaica's shores and influencing global genres. Its vibrant energy and direct lyrics continue to resonate with audiences worldwide, establishing its place as a cornerstone of world culture.

Pulse & Girl: Exploring Dancehall Scene

Dancehall, born from the heart of Jamaica, is far more than just a sound; it's a vibrant social phenomenon. The concept "Riddim & Gyal" perfectly encapsulates two essential elements of this dynamic domain. The "Riddim," alluding to the infectious, looped drum patterns that define the music, provides the base for the dance. And the "Gyal," standing for the confident, independent women whose attitudes are inextricably connected with the dancehall vibe. It’s a celebration of movement, community, and genuine Jamaican identity, giving rise to a global expression trend. From the studios of Kingston to dance floors worldwide, this mix of music and movement continues to captivate and inspire a growing audience.
